Gluten-Free Brioche Burger Buns

Fluffy, homemade brioche burger buns made with gluten-free ingredients, perfect for elevating your burger game without the guilt.
Prep Time 1 hour
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 20 minutes
Servings: 8 buns
Course: Side, Snack
Cuisine: American
Calories: 150

Ingredients
  

Dry Ingredients
  • 2 cups gluten-free all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 cup almond flour Can substitute with coconut flour.
  • 1/4 cup sugar Add more for sweeter buns.
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1 tbsp instant yeast
Wet Ingredients
  • 1/2 cup warm milk (dairy or non-dairy)
  • 1/4 cup melted butter or coconut oil
  • 2 large eggs For vegan, substitute with flax eggs.
Toppings
  • to taste sesame seeds (optional) For topping.

Method
 

Preparation
  1. In a large bowl, mix together the gluten-free flour, almond flour, sugar, salt, and instant yeast.
  2. In another bowl, whisk together the warm milk, melted butter, and eggs.
  3. Gradually add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ients and mix until a dough forms.
  4. Cover the bowl with a clean towel and let the dough rise in a warm place for about 1 hour.
  5.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
Baking
  1. Divide the dough into equal portions and shape into buns.
  2. Place the buns on a parchment-lined baking sheet and sprinkle sesame seeds on top if desired.
  3. Bake for 15-20 minutes or until golden brown.
  4. Let the buns cool before using them for burgers.

Notes

For best results, don't rush the rising time. Store leftovers in the fridge for 3-5 days or freeze for up to 3 months. Reheat before serving.
